Learn MorePlaying for Heroes – Acoustic Live is a series of intimate, acoustic live music evenings hosted in restaurants and small venues. Guests enjoy a high-quality musical experience while dining, and are invited to contribute to a cause that truly matters.
Every event is designed to be warm, personal and respectful in tone, creating a setting where music connects people and generosity feels natural.
100% of the proceeds go directly to children growing up in war zones.
There are no hidden costs, no deductions and no intermediaries. What is raised during the evening goes entirely to organisations that support children affected by war.
Playing for Heroes – Acoustic Live supports carefully selected foundations that work directly with children affected by war.
One of the foundations we support is Children of Heroes, an organisation dedicated to helping children who have lost one or both parents due to armed conflict.
We choose our partner foundations based on transparency, direct impact and their ability to make a meaningful difference in the lives of children in need.

Sponsors play a crucial role in making Playing for Heroes – Acoustic Live fully transparent and impactful.
Sponsors cover the overhead costs of your donation of the foundations we support. In this way, we can ensure that 100% of every donation goes directly to children in need — without deductions, administration fees or hidden expenses.
